CMS? You need one of them too?

In my opinion, any website provider not setting their clients up on a Content Management System should be dragged out to the stocks, to have rotting vegetables thrown at them! 

wordpress-logo-3.5.2-release

There’s no excuse for a site not to based on some sort of CMS and in my view, the easier the better.

My plug is for WordPress, the CMS running this site (as well as about 76 million sites like this) – We were using a far more comprehensive beast titled Typo3 but it was far in excess of our needs. WordPress powers millions of sites and best of all, it’s free.

It’s also easy to learn and operate – which means you shouldn’t HAVE to call in your ‘Web Designer’ every time you need a change or addition … it’s possible for even the most junior of your staff to edit in WordPress after minutes of training.
